DIAMOND PLATNUMZ PLEADS WITH TANZANIAN GOVERNMENT TO MAKE HIS WEDDING DATE A PUBLIC HOLIDAY

Popular musician, Diamond Platnumz wants the government of Tanzania to make his wedding date a public holiday. The Tanzanian superstar singer is engaged to be married to his Kenyan girlfriend, and this has got everyone talking after he revealed how big he really wants the event to be.

The singer is a divorced father of three children but is now engaged to Kenyan model and radio presenter, Tansha Donna Barbieri. The singer has said openly that he wants to have a very elaborate wedding and has pleaded with the government to declare that one day a public holiday so all his family members will be chanced to be in attendance.

In December 2018, the singer officially announced his intentions to marry his better half on Valentine’s Day, 2019. Recent reports however show that he extended the dates because some super star celebrities like Rick Ross could not make it. This is coming several months after his longtime partner and mother of two of his kids, Zara Hassan dumped him. The stunning business mogul who is alleged to be 9-years older than the artiste has decided to leave the marriage due to the constant news of his cheating.
